**Break-glass: Pagewright API pagination service**

If cursor tokens stop resolving and customers report looping pages, do not restart the token signer blindly — active cursors will invalidate. Instead, open the break-glass console, drain the signer, and rotate keys in order. The console requires the on-call recovery passphrase, which is:

strongbox words: wenix-ulador

Subject: DR drill tomorrow — autocomplete index heads-up

Hi all, welcome aboard! Tomorrow's disaster-recovery drill at Larkspool will fail over the search cluster, so expect the autocomplete index on Bramblehut to crawl for an hour or two. Totally normal, don't page anyone. If the standby node asks you to restore the index snapshot, use the recovery passphrase right below this line.

unlock words, hahip-baduf: holwyn-istath-julvan

Break-glass: PickPath Optimizer (Varnholt Logistics). Release manager only. Use when the optimizer deadlocks mid-wave and normal admin auth is down. Page second approver, open the sealed escrow entry, and restart the solver node. Log everything in the incident channel within 15 minutes. The break-glass passphrase is on the next line.

strongbox words: sorir-belvan-rusix-ulays-ralmir-praix-eliir-tamax-praael-druael-julir-tamius-jorir

# Greenhouse controller — sensor drift notes (support)
# Verdanthaus units drift on humidity sensors after ~90 days.
# Controller applies a rolling offset; raw vs corrected values
# both logged. If corrected readings look wrong, clear the
# offset cache and let it rebuild overnight.
# Calibration history lives in the telemetry DB.
# To query it, connect using the string below.

primary connection of tajeg-tajop = postgresql://julax_svc:DI@db-e7f3.kelvidyn.corp:5432/rusdor